Institutional Judgment & Organizational Continuity

Preserving wisdom beyond employee tenure and executive turnover

Core Proposition

"Companies invest heavily in talent acquisition but allow the most valuable output of senior talent—accumulated judgment—to evaporate upon employee resignation."

Theoretical Foundation & Operational Mechanics

When a senior leader departs an organization, HR calculates the replacement cost of recruiting, onboarding, and salary. What is rarely calculated is the catastrophic loss of institutional wisdom. A seasoned leader knows: - Which vendor negotiations carry hidden landmines. - Which structural reorganizations failed four years ago and why. - How complex client contracts were interpreted during past crises. - Which team dynamics require delicate handling. Without systematic decision intelligence, every departure resets the learning curve. New executives repeat past mistakes under the impression they are pioneering bold new strategies. Transforming individual expertise into institutional judgment is the ultimate frontier of sustainable competitive advantage.
Applied Scenario

Real-World Corporate Application

Context & Challenge:

A global auto-component manufacturer faces the retirement of its veteran Head of Plant HR and Labor Relations.

Conventional Approach

A two-week handover meeting produces a 20-page Word document that captures contacts and open grievances, but loses 25 years of nuance regarding labor negotiations and local precedent.

Decision Intelligence Approach

Key past arbitration outcomes, negotiated trade-offs, union precedents, and escalation histories have been recorded in an institutional decision repository over time.

Resulting Organizational Outcome:

The successor navigates subsequent union discussions with full awareness of historical agreements and boundaries, preserving labor harmony and credibility.
